Bug 958691 - nfs-root-squash: rename creates a file on a file residing inside a sticky bit set directory
Summary: nfs-root-squash: rename creates a file on a file residing inside a sticky bit...
Keywords:
Status: CLOSED CURRENTRELEASE
Alias: None
Product: GlusterFS
Classification: Community
Component: access-control
Version: mainline
Hardware: x86_64
OS: All
medium
urgent
Target Milestone: ---
Assignee: Raghavendra Bhat
QA Contact:
URL:
Whiteboard:
Depends On: 956957
Blocks:
TreeView+ depends on / blocked
 
Reported: 2013-05-02 08:48 UTC by Raghavendra Bhat
Modified: 2014-06-13 05:52 UTC (History)
6 users (show)

Fixed In Version: glusterfs-3.5.0
Doc Type: Bug Fix
Doc Text:
Clone Of: 956957
Environment:
Last Closed: 2014-04-17 11:41:59 UTC
Regression: ---
Mount Type: ---
Documentation: ---
CRM:
Verified Versions:
Embargoed:


Attachments (Terms of Use)

Comment 1 Anand Avati 2013-05-02 08:50:21 UTC
REVIEW: http://review.gluster.org/4934 (system/posix-acl: check for the sticky bit of the parent directory) posted (#1) for review on master by Raghavendra Bhat (raghavendra)

Comment 2 Anand Avati 2013-05-02 08:52:20 UTC
REVIEW: http://review.gluster.org/4934 (system/posix-acl: check for the sticky bit of the parent directory) posted (#2) for review on master by Raghavendra Bhat (raghavendra)

Comment 3 Raghavendra Bhat 2013-05-02 11:23:10 UTC
http://review.gluster.org/#/c/4934/ has been submitted for review.

Comment 4 Anand Avati 2013-06-03 23:11:44 UTC
COMMIT: http://review.gluster.org/4934 committed in master by Anand Avati (avati) 
------
commit 3f5e575a0744488b4a1719c3e61864c3abc9ac22
Author: Raghavendra Bhat <raghavendra>
Date:   Thu May 2 12:56:46 2013 +0530

    system/posix-acl: check for the sticky bit of the parent directory
    
    * While creating links, check if there is sticky bit set for the parent
      directory and whether the sticky bit permits the user to create the link.
    
    Change-Id: Ic0d09d9ed579c4eb47462c71602a3a60cc7d3bc1
    BUG: 958691
    Signed-off-by: Raghavendra Bhat <raghavendra>
    Reviewed-on: http://review.gluster.org/4934
    Reviewed-by: Amar Tumballi <amarts>
    Tested-by: Gluster Build System <jenkins.com>
    Reviewed-by: Anand Avati <avati>

Comment 5 Anand Avati 2013-09-05 10:40:27 UTC
REVIEW: http://review.gluster.org/5813 (system/posix-acl: check for the sticky bit of the parent directory) posted (#1) for review on release-3.4 by Vijay Bellur (vbellur)

Comment 6 Anand Avati 2013-09-05 15:12:10 UTC
REVIEW: http://review.gluster.org/5813 (system/posix-acl: check for the sticky bit of the parent directory) posted (#2) for review on release-3.4 by Vijay Bellur (vbellur)

Comment 7 Anand Avati 2013-09-06 04:26:12 UTC
REVIEW: http://review.gluster.org/5813 (system/posix-acl: check for the sticky bit of the parent directory) posted (#3) for review on release-3.4 by Vijay Bellur (vbellur)

Comment 8 Anand Avati 2013-09-06 07:42:10 UTC
REVIEW: http://review.gluster.org/5813 (system/posix-acl: check for the sticky bit of the parent directory) posted (#4) for review on release-3.4 by Vijay Bellur (vbellur)

Comment 9 Anand Avati 2013-09-07 15:00:24 UTC
REVIEW: http://review.gluster.org/5813 (system/posix-acl: check for the sticky bit of the parent directory) posted (#5) for review on release-3.4 by Vijay Bellur (vbellur)

Comment 10 Anand Avati 2013-09-10 00:24:56 UTC
COMMIT: http://review.gluster.org/5813 committed in release-3.4 by Anand Avati (avati) 
------
commit 975d0c003ac77a28be2847fb96a8a86251ee08b2
Author: Raghavendra Bhat <raghavendra>
Date:   Thu May 2 12:56:46 2013 +0530

    system/posix-acl: check for the sticky bit of the parent directory
    
    * While creating links, check if there is sticky bit set for the parent
      directory and whether the sticky bit permits the user to create the link.
    
    Change-Id: Ic0d09d9ed579c4eb47462c71602a3a60cc7d3bc1
    BUG: 958691
    Signed-off-by: Raghavendra Bhat <raghavendra>
    Reviewed-on: http://review.gluster.org/4934
    Reviewed-by: Amar Tumballi <amarts>
    Tested-by: Gluster Build System <jenkins.com>
    Reviewed-by: Anand Avati <avati>
    Reviewed-on: http://review.gluster.org/5813
    Reviewed-by: Kaleb KEITHLEY <kkeithle>

Comment 11 Niels de Vos 2014-04-17 11:41:59 UTC
This bug is getting closed because a release has been made available that should address the reported issue. In case the problem is still not fixed with glusterfs-3.5.0, please reopen this bug report.

glusterfs-3.5.0 has been announced on the Gluster Developers mailinglist [1], packages for several distributions should become available in the near future. Keep an eye on the Gluster Users mailinglist [2] and the update infrastructure for your distribution.

[1] http://thread.gmane.org/gmane.comp.file-systems.gluster.devel/6137
[2] http://thread.gmane.org/gmane.comp.file-systems.gluster.user


Note You need to log in before you can comment on or make changes to this bug.